Anthem Business Analyst Interview Process

The interview process for a Business Analyst position at Anthem is structured to assess both technical skills and cultural fit within the organization. It typically unfolds in several stages, allowing candidates to showcase their expertise and problem-solving abilities.

1. Initial Screening

The process begins with an initial screening, which is usually a phone interview conducted by a recruiter or HR representative. This conversation focuses on understanding the candidate's background, relevant experience, and motivation for applying to Anthem. The recruiter will also provide an overview of the company culture and the specific expectations for the Business Analyst role.

2. Technical Interview

Following the initial screening, candidates typically participate in a technical interview. This may be conducted via phone or video conference and often involves discussions around the candidate's previous projects, particularly those related to data analysis, market research, and business requirements mapping. Candidates should be prepared to demonstrate their analytical skills and familiarity with tools such as SQL, Excel, and any relevant project management methodologies like Agile.

3. Behavioral Interviews

Candidates will then move on to a series of behavioral interviews, which may include multiple rounds with different team members, including peers and hiring managers. These interviews focus on assessing the candidate's problem-solving abilities, teamwork, and adaptability. Interviewers may ask situational questions that require candidates to describe how they have handled challenges in previous roles, particularly in relation to stakeholder management and communication.

4. Final Interview

The final stage often includes a more in-depth interview with senior management or executives. This round may involve scenario-based questions that test the candidate's critical thinking and decision-making skills. Candidates might be asked to present insights or analyses they have conducted in the past, showcasing their ability to communicate complex information effectively to stakeholders.

Throughout the interview process, candidates should be ready to discuss their understanding of the healthcare industry, as well as their experience with pricing models and competitive analysis, which are crucial for the Business Analyst role at Anthem.

Anthem Business Analyst Interview Tips

Here are some tips to help you excel in your interview.

Understand the Business Landscape

Familiarize yourself with the healthcare industry, particularly Anthem's position within it. Research recent trends, challenges, and innovations in healthcare analytics and business insights. This knowledge will not only help you answer questions more effectively but also demonstrate your genuine interest in the role and the company.

Highlight Relevant Experience

Be prepared to discuss your previous roles and how they relate to the responsibilities of a Business Analyst. Use specific examples that showcase your skills in market research, pricing models, and data analysis. Tailor your responses to reflect how your background aligns with Anthem's needs, particularly in areas like competitor analysis and client feedback management.

Prepare for Behavioral Questions

Anthem's interview process may include behavioral questions that assess your problem-solving abilities and how you handle criticism. Reflect on past experiences where you faced challenges and how you overcame them.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ers, ensuring you convey your thought process clearly.

Emphasize Technical Proficiency

Given the technical nature of the role, be ready to discuss your experience with tools and methodologies relevant to business analysis. This may include your familiarity with SQL, Excel, and any project management tools like Jira. If you have experience with Agile methodologies, be sure to highlight that as well, as it may resonate with the interviewers.

Engage with the Interviewers

During the interview, actively engage with your interviewers by asking insightful questions about the team dynamics, current projects, and the company culture. This not only shows your interest but also helps you gauge if Anthem is the right fit for you. Be prepared to discuss how you can contribute to the team and the company’s goals.

Be Authentic and Personable

While it's important to present your qualifications, don't forget to let your personality shine through. Anthem values candidates who are passionate and can contribute positively to the team culture. Share your motivations for wanting to work at Anthem and how you align with their mission and values.

Follow Up Thoughtfully

After your interviews, send a personalized thank-you note to each interviewer. Reference specific topics discussed during your conversation to reinforce your interest and appreciation for the opportunity. This small gesture can leave a lasting impression and demonstrate your professionalism.

By following these tips, you'll be well-prepared to showcase your skills and fit for the Business Analyst role at Anthem. Good luck!

Anthem Business Analyst Interview Questions

In this section, we’ll review the various interview questions that might be asked during an interview for a Business Analyst role at Anthem. The interview process will likely focus on your analytical skills, experience with business requirements, and ability to communicate insights effectively. Be prepared to discuss your past experiences and how they relate to the responsibilities of the role.

Experience and Background

1. Can you describe your experience with mapping business requirements?

This question aims to assess your understanding of business analysis and your practical experience in gathering and documenting requirements.

How to Answer

Discuss specific projects where you successfully mapped business requirements, emphasizing your approach to stakeholder engagement and documentation.

Example

“In my previous role, I led a project where I collaborated with stakeholders to gather requirements for a new software implementation. I utilized interviews and workshops to ensure all perspectives were captured, and I documented the requirements in a clear and structured format, which facilitated a smooth development process.”

Analytical Skills

2. Describe a difficult situation at work and how you handled it.

This question evaluates your problem-solving skills and ability to navigate challenges in a business environment.

How to Answer

Choose a specific example that highlights your analytical thinking and how you approached the problem, including the steps you took to resolve it.

Example

“In one instance, our team faced a significant delay in project delivery due to unforeseen technical issues. I organized a meeting with the development team to analyze the root cause and collaborated with them to create a revised timeline. By maintaining open communication with stakeholders, we managed to realign expectations and successfully delivered the project with minimal disruption.”

Communication and Reporting

3. How do you ensure that your reports are clear and actionable for senior stakeholders?

This question assesses your ability to communicate complex information effectively.

How to Answer

Discuss your approach to report writing, including how you tailor your content to the audience and ensure clarity.

Example

“I focus on understanding the key interests of my audience before drafting reports. I use clear headings, bullet points, and visuals to present data succinctly. Additionally, I summarize key findings and recommendations at the beginning of the report to ensure that senior stakeholders can quickly grasp the essential insights.”

Technical Skills

4. Can you describe your experience with SQL and how you have used it in your previous roles?

This question tests your technical proficiency and ability to analyze data.

How to Answer

Provide specific examples of how you have utilized SQL to extract and analyze data, highlighting any relevant projects.

Example

“In my last position, I used SQL to extract data from our customer database to analyze purchasing trends. I wrote complex queries to join multiple tables, which allowed me to generate insights that informed our marketing strategies and improved customer targeting.”

Business Insight and Market Research

5. How do you approach competitor analysis to identify growth opportunities?

This question evaluates your research skills and strategic thinking.

How to Answer

Explain your methodology for conducting competitor analysis, including the tools and frameworks you use.

Example

“I typically start by gathering data on competitors’ products, pricing, and market positioning. I use SWOT analysis to evaluate their strengths and weaknesses compared to our offerings. This comprehensive approach helps me identify gaps in the market and potential areas for growth, which I then present to the team for strategic planning.”
